Why the map you grew up with disagrees
On a Mercator map, area grows with distance from the equator. Jamaica sits at about 18°N and is stretched to 1.11× its true area; Russia at 66° N is stretched to 6.06×. That difference is why Russia looks so much bigger than it is next to Jamaica. The figure above uses the Equal Earth projection, where every square kilometre is drawn the same size.
